Quick and Easy Crochet Snuggle

ImageThis is an extremely easy Snuggle pattern that even the most inexperienced crocheter can make. It is a great teaching pattern for beginners as well as a good exercise pattern for the elderly with hand/arm disabilites.

Materials: Double strands of Worsted weight, acrylic, size M (13) hook.

Directions: Chain to desired width (add 1 for turning chain).

Stitches: Single Crochet (sc)

Row 1 (right side): ch in 2nd ch from hook, sc in each ch st across, ch1, turn.

Row 2: sc in each st across, ch1, turn.

Repeat Row 2 for pattern until desired size. Finish off.

If you like, you can work a border around the snuggle to give it personality and to stop the piece from curling.

For best results in finishing, break off ends long and weave through using a tapestry needle.
